NPOI 2.4.0版本DLL文件压缩包解析

需积分: 18 2 下载量 85 浏览量 更新于2024-11-02 收藏 6.25MB ZIP 举报
资源摘要信息:"NPOI是.NET平台的一个开源库,主要用于读取和写入Microsoft Office格式的文件,比如Word(.doc, .docx), Excel(.xls, .xlsx)和PowerPoint(.ppt, .pptx)等。2.4.0版本是该库的一个特定版本,提供了对不同Office文件格式的API支持,使得开发者可以在.NET应用程序中轻松地处理这些文件。NPOI库的使用可以避免依赖Microsoft Office的Primary Interop Assemblies(PIA),并且能够在不安装Office应用程序的服务器上运行。 NPOI.2.4.0.zip文件是一个压缩包,其中包含了编译生成的4个dll文件。这些dll文件包含了NPOI库实现的所有功能和类,允许.NET开发人员将它们引入到项目中以实现对Office文件的操作。具体包含的dll文件和它们的功能可能包括但不限于: 1. Npoi.Core.dll:这是NPOI库的核心组件,包含了处理Office文档所必需的基本类和接口。它可能包含了解析和创建Excel和Word文档的基础代码,以及其他支持类。 2. Npoi.SS.UserModel.dll:专门用于Excel文件操作的dll,提供了对Excel工作簿、工作表、单元格等对象的访问和编辑能力。 3. Npoi.HSSF.UserModel.dll:包含用于处理较老的Excel格式(.xls)的API。它是NPOI的一个组件,提供了对Excel 97-2003文件格式的读写支持。 4. Npoi.XSSF.UserModel.dll:类似于Npoi.SS.UserModel.dll,但它专注于处理新的Excel文件格式(.xlsx),适用于Excel 2007及以后的版本。 NPOI的这些dll文件能够通过NuGet包管理器轻松地集成到.NET项目中。一旦集成,开发者可以利用NPOI提供的API来操作Office文档,例如创建新文档、修改现有文档、提取文档信息以及转换文档格式等。这一功能在需要自动化Office文档处理的场景下尤其有用,例如报表生成、数据导入导出、自动化测试生成文档等。由于NPOI是开源的,所以无需担心许可费用,这为很多中小规模的项目提供了便利。 总的来说,NPOI.2.4.0.zip压缩包以及其中的dll文件,对于那些需要在.NET环境中处理Office文档的开发者来说,是一个非常有用的资源。无论是开发企业级应用程序还是小型脚本工具,NPOI都能提供强大的功能来简化Office文档处理的复杂性。"